In vitro antifungal activity of allicin alone and in combination with two medications against six dermatophytic fungi
Dermatophytes are fungi capable of invading keratinized tissues of humans and animals, causingdermatomycosis. Azole antifungal drugs are often used in the treatment of dermatomycosis.
